Output 22dda025ffe3dee89c027e076936d151c65c3211d286e2ac692ecd4eacca04dc:0

value
351876341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7704606fb16c27644fe4b66fea3fa590a81b4502 OP_EQUAL
address
MJkTtMeNe44ids7fyq1gxV15oPv18oPP6B
transaction
22dda025ffe3dee89c027e076936d151c65c3211d286e2ac692ecd4eacca04dc
spent
true